The Sony KV-36XBR450 is a cathode ray tube television that, despite its age, has some undeniable advantages. The remarkable image quality offered by Sony technology allows for vibrant colors and striking contrasts, ensuring a pleasant viewing experience for users. Additionally, the Sony brand is synonymous with reliability and durability, which reassures about the longevity of this model. Ease of use is also a strong point, thanks to the available documents, such as the user manual and the installation guide, which facilitate the setup. However, this model has notable drawbacks. As a cathode ray tube television, it is bulky and difficult to move, making it less practical than modern flat-screen televisions. The display technology is outdated, offering inferior image quality compared to recent LCD or OLED models, which may disappoint users looking for high definition. Furthermore, connectivity is limited, with a restricted number of HDMI ports, making it more complicated to use with recent devices. Finally, energy consumption is generally higher for this type of television, which can lead to additional electricity costs in the long run. In summary, the Sony KV-36XBR450 may suit those who prioritize a proven brand and an easy user experience, but it may disappoint those seeking modern performance, extensive connectivity, and cutting-edge image quality.

What is the recommended viewing distance for my Sony television?
The optimal viewing distance for your Sony television varies depending on the screen size. Generally, it is advised to sit about 2.4 times the diagonal of the screen.
What should I do if my television is no longer receiving a signal?
If your television is not picking up a signal, you can check the following: - Make sure your television is on the correct source. - Check that your television is properly connected via the HDMI or SCART input.
What are the dimensions of my television screen?
The size of your television is usually indicated in inches, with 1 inch equaling 2.54 centimeters. This measurement corresponds to the diagonal of the screen, which you should measure from the bottom left corner to the top right corner.
What does the acronym HDMI stand for?
HDMI, which stands for High-Definition Multimedia Interface, is a cable that transmits audio and video signals between different devices.
